Electrical Security
Electrical methods are one other vital part of pool draining. To make sure protected operation, observe these tips:
* Use correctly grounded gear: All electrical gear must be grounded to stop electrocution and electrical shocks.
* Hold electrical gear dry: Keep away from working electrical gear in areas the place it could be uncovered to water or different liquids.
* Examine electrical cords and wiring: Often examine electrical cords and wiring for indicators of harm or put on, and substitute them as wanted.
* Use GFCI-protected shops: Floor Fault Circuit Interrupter (GFCI) shops might help forestall electrical shocks and electrocution.

Retesting Pool Water Chemistry
Retesting the pool water chemistry entails checking the degrees of assorted parameters, together with pH, alkalinity, calcium hardness, and chlorine. That is accomplished to establish any potential imbalances that will have occurred in the course of the draining course of.
- Measure pH ranges to make sure they fall throughout the optimum vary of seven.2-7.8.
- Test alkalinity ranges, aiming for at least 80-120 ppm to stop pH fluctuations.
- Confirm calcium hardness ranges, concentrating on a minimal of 175-225 ppm to stop scaling.
- Check chlorine ranges to make sure they’re throughout the really helpful vary of 1-3 ppm.
Adjusting Chemical Ranges
Based mostly on the retesting outcomes, modify the chemical ranges accordingly. It is important to observe the producer’s directions for every chemical product to keep away from over- or under-dosing.
- Add pH adjusters, equivalent to sodium carbonate or muriatic acid, to regulate pH ranges.
- Apply alkalinity increasers, equivalent to sodium bicarbonate, to keep up optimum alkalinity ranges.
- Use calcium hardness increasers, like calcium chloride, to stop scaling.
- Rechlorinate the pool by including chlorine tablets or granules, taking care to not over-chlorinate.

Q: How typically ought to I drain my pool?
A: The frequency of draining a pool is dependent upon numerous elements, together with utilization, water high quality, and local weather. As a normal rule, pool house owners ought to drain their pool each 1-3 years, or as really helpful by the producer.
